Delimiter Converter
← Retour au blog

Comment identifier ou vérifier le délimiteur d'un fichier texte inconnu

April 13, 2026 712 words

Vous venez de recevoir un fichier texte sans instructions, sans contexte et sans aucune idée de ce qu'il contient. Vous l'ouvrez et découvrez un mur de données séparées par quelque chose. Est-ce une virgule ? Un pipe ? Une tabulation ? Déterminer le délimiteur d'un fichier inconnu est une compétence indispensable pour toute personne travaillant avec des données, et c'est plus facile qu'on ne le pense quand on sait quoi chercher.

Qu'est-ce qu'un délimiteur et pourquoi est-ce important ?

Un délimiteur est un caractère utilisé pour séparer les valeurs dans un fichier texte. Lorsqu'un logiciel lit ce fichier, il utilise le délimiteur pour savoir où un champ se termine et où le suivant commence. Si vous vous trompez, vos données s'importent sous forme d'un mélange incompréhensible.

Les délimiteurs courants incluent les virgules, les tabulations, les pipes, les points-virgules et les espaces. Certains fichiers utilisent même des caractères inhabituels comme les tildes ou les deux-points. Identifier le bon délimiteur avant d'importer ou de traiter le fichier vous évite bien des maux de tête.

Les délimiteurs courants que vous rencontrerez

Voici un récapitulatif des délimiteurs que vous êtes le plus susceptible de rencontrer :

Délimiteur Caractère Cas d'utilisation courant
Virgule , Fichiers CSV, exports de tableurs
Tabulation \t Fichiers TSV, exports de bases de données
Pipe | Systèmes legacy, données EDI
Point-virgule ; Formats CSV européens
Espace (espace) Fichiers de logs, données à largeur fixe

Comment vérifier le délimiteur manuellement

La méthode la plus rapide consiste à ouvrir le fichier dans un éditeur de texte brut comme Notepad, TextEdit ou VS Code. Ne l'ouvrez pas encore dans Excel, car Excel tentera de l'interpréter automatiquement et masquera ce qu'il contient réellement.

  1. Ouvrez le fichier dans un éditeur de texte brut.
  2. Examinez les deux ou trois premières lignes de données.
  3. Repérez le caractère qui apparaît de manière constante entre chaque valeur.
  4. Comptez le nombre d'occurrences par ligne. Un nombre constant confirme généralement le délimiteur.
  5. Vérifiez si les champs texte sont encadrés par des guillemets, ce qui peut affecter l'apparence des délimiteurs.

Si le fichier ressemble à nom,age,ville sur la première ligne, le délimiteur est presque certainement une virgule. Si les valeurs sont séparées par un espace plus large, il s'agit probablement d'un caractère de tabulation, car les tabulations ne s'affichent pas sous forme de symboles visibles dans la plupart des éditeurs.

⚠️ Attention aux virgules à l'intérieur des champs entre guillemets. Une valeur comme "Dupont, Jean" contient une virgule, mais ce n'est pas un délimiteur. Vérifiez toujours si les champs sont encadrés par des guillemets avant de supposer que chaque virgule sépare des valeurs.

Utiliser des outils logiciels pour détecter le délimiteur

Lorsqu'un fichier est volumineux ou que le motif n'est pas évident, des logiciels peuvent vous aider. De nombreux outils détectent automatiquement le délimiteur en analysant la fréquence d'apparition de chaque caractère à intervalles réguliers sur les différentes lignes.

Vous pouvez également utiliser un convertisseur de délimiteurs en ligne pour coller vos données et tester rapidement différents séparateurs. C'est un moyen pratique de visualiser le résultat avant de lancer un import.

Vérifications rapides dans un tableur

  • Importez le fichier à l'aide de l'« Assistant d'importation de texte » dans Excel ou Google Sheets.
  • Sélectionnez différentes options de délimiteur et prévisualisez les colonnes.
  • Si les données se répartissent en colonnes propres et logiques, vous avez trouvé le bon délimiteur.
  • Si tout se retrouve dans une seule colonne, essayez un autre séparateur.

Points clés à retenir

  • La détection du délimiteur commence par l'ouverture du fichier dans un éditeur de texte brut, et non dans un tableur.
  • Les délimiteurs les plus courants sont la virgule, la tabulation, le pipe et le point-virgule.
  • Une fréquence de caractère constante d'une ligne à l'autre est le signal le plus fiable que vous avez trouvé le bon délimiteur.
  • Les champs entre guillemets peuvent contenir des caractères de délimitation sans pour autant servir de séparateurs : lisez attentivement.
  • Des outils en ligne comme un convertisseur virgule vers pipe vous permettent de tester et d'interchanger les délimiteurs instantanément.

Quand le format reste flou

Certains fichiers sont réellement complexes. Les fichiers à largeur fixe n'utilisent aucun délimiteur et reposent sur des positions de colonnes. D'autres peuvent mélanger les espaces de manière incohérente. Si vous êtes face à un format véritablement inconnu, consultez toute documentation associée, contactez la source du fichier ou examinez les extensions comme .csv, .tsv ou .psv pour obtenir des indices.

Vous pouvez également nettoyer des données texte désordonnées avec un outil de transformation de texte pour supprimer les espaces ou caractères superflus qui pourraient fausser votre analyse. Un peu de prétraitement fait toute la différence lorsque des fichiers au format inconnu vous posent problème.